A three bedroomed mews style town house set in an exclusive courtyard development, adjacent to St. Marys Church and being within walking distance of the railway station. The property is of unique design with irregular shaped rooms set over three floors. Benefits include sealed unit double glazed windows, gas radiator central heating and built in kitchen appliances. The accommodation briefly comprises entrance hall, cloakroom, lounge, kitchen/breakfast room, master bedroom with ensuite shower room, two further bedrooms, bathroom and two parking spaces.

Enter via obscure glazed entrance door to.
Entrance Hall Radiator, meter cupboard, wood effect laminate floor, inset ceiling lights, stairs to first floor landing, doors to.
Cloakroom Comprising low flush W.C., wall mounted wash basin with tiled splash backs, radiator, electric extractor vent, ceramic tiled floor.
Kitchen/Breakfast Room 20' 1" max x 17' 8" max (6.12m x 5.38m) (This measurement includes the area occupied by the kitchen units)
Good family room with one and a half bowl single drainer sink unit, mixer tap, range of base and eye level units providing work surfaces, tiled splash areas, built in electric oven, gas hob and extractor hood over, plumbing for washing machine, space for fridge/freezer, two double radiators, telephone point, ceramic tiled floor, window to rear aspect, window to front aspect, French doors with windows either side to rear garden.
First Floor Landing Window to rear aspect (over staircase), double radiator, doors to.
Lounge 17' 6" max x 10' 9" max (5.33m x 3.28m) French doors with further window to Juliet balcony, double radiator, T.V. point, telephone point, wood effect laminate floor.
Bedroom One 13' 4" max x 9' 0" min (4.06m x 2.74m) Two windows to rear aspect, radiator, built in wardrobe, wood effect laminate floor, telephone point, T.V. point, door to.
Ensuite Shower Room Comprising tiled shower enclosure, pedestal hand wash basin, low flush W.C., tiled splash areas, double radiator, electric extractor vent, ceramic tiled floor.
Second Floor Landing Window to rear aspect (over staircase), sky light window, access to loft space, airing cupboard housing gas fired boiler serving central heating and domestic hot water, doors to.
Bedroom Two 13' 6" max x 10' 10" max (4.11m x 3.3m) Window to front aspect, radiator, telephone point, T.V. point, wood effect laminate floor.
Bedroom Three 16' 10" max x 8' 10" upto wardrobe (5.13m x 2.69m) Two sky light windows, double radiator, T.V. point, telephone point, built in wardrobe, wood effect laminate floor.
Bathroom Comprising panelled bath with mixer shower attachment, pedestal hand wash basin, low flush W.C., tiled splash areas, electric shaver point, radiator, electric extractor vent, ceramic tiled floor.
Outside Rear - Decking, lawn, tree, outside tap, light, power point, brick wall and wooden fence, gated access to rear.
Front - Two parking spaces, additional visitor spaces
N.B The vendor advises that a fee of £60pcm is paid to St. Marys Paddock Management Company Limited for management/service charge. This charge covers building insurance, communal lighting, cameras, maintaining the communal gardens to the car park, external cleaning of fixtures, clearing of gutters as appropriate and external redecoration every five years.
The rooms are of an irregular shape and measurements quoted are maximum sizes, these will taper on angles to smaller sizes.
